Auto standby selector switch (AUTO STANDBY)
ON : The auto standby function is activated
OFF : The auto standby function is deactivated
i
Status indicator
The two-colored LED indicates the active
subwoofers operating status, as follows:
Power ON...............................Lights green
Auto power off (standby mode) .....Lights red
Power OFF .....................................LED off
Protective circuit activated..........Flashing red

Power switch (POWER)
The power turns on when this switch is set to
the ON position.
Several seconds are required for the set to
begin operating. This is because the set
includes a built-in muting circuit to prevent
noise when the power switch is turned on and
off.
When set to the OFF position, the power
turns off.
Auto Standby Function
The amplifier is automatically set to the standby
mode if no signal is input for 5 to 11 minutes,
thereby saving electricity.
The power turns on immediately when a signal
is input.
CAUTION:
Do not plug the AC power cord into an AC power outlet until all connections have been completed.
Check the left and right channels and be sure to interconnect them properly, L (left) to L, R (right) to R.
Plug the AC power cord in securely. An insecure connection could cause noise.
Note that clamping pin-plug cords and power cords together or running pin-plug cords near the power
transformer could result in humming or noise.
Check the polarities of the speakers and amplifier and be sure to interconnect properly. Connect the red
terminal on the speaker to the + speaker terminal on the amplifier, the black terminal on the speaker to
the “–” speaker terminal on the amplifier.
CONNECTIONS
(1) Connecting the line input connector (LINE IN)
* Connect this to the pre-out connector for the active subwoofer on the AV amplifier (SUBWOOFER PREOUT,
MONO OUT, etc.) using the included connection cord (3-meter RCA pin cord).
CAUTION:
If this connector is connected to the pre-out connector for the surround center channel of a stereo amplifier
or AV surround amplifier, only the center channels bass sound will be produced, so the overall bass sound
will be insufficient.

Crossover adjustment control (CROSSOVER)
This control only functions when the LF
DIRECT switch (
r
) is set to the OFF
position.
This control sets the upper limit of the
frequencies reproduced by the active
subwoofer.
Setting criteria
50Hz : For left/right speakers with
diameters of 20 cm or greater
100Hz : For left/right speakers with
diameters between 10 and 25 cm
200Hz : For left/right speakers with
diameters of 12 cm or less
When using a Dolby Digital- or dts-compatible
AV amplifier, we recommend turning the LF
DIRECT switch (
r
) to the ON position and
not using this function.

Volume adjustment control (LEVEL)
This control only functions when the LF
DIRECT switch (
r
) is set to the OFF
position.
Use this control to adjust the volume of the
active subwoofer.
When turned clockwise ( ) from the center
position, the volume of the active subwoofer
increases, and when turned counterclockwise
( ), the volume decreases. Set to the
desired position.
